一、ContextLoaderListener

原因:SpringMVC提供控制层,负责请求和响应。Controller要调用Service,Service是由Spring IOC提供,而Controller由SpringMVC IOC提供,所以我们需要首先创建Spring IOC,然后才能获取里面的bean对象。

监听器的执行顺序先于过滤器,过滤器的执行顺序先于service。

Spring中有三种监听器:ServletContextListener,HttpSessionListener,HttpSessionAttributeListener。

ContextLoaderListener实现了ServletContextListener接口,可以监听ServletContext的状态,在web服务器的启动时读取Spring核心配置文件,创建Spring IOC容器。

配置ContextLoaderListener的位置:web.xml

<!-- 配置监听器,当服务器启动时,初始化 Spring IOC 容器 -->
<listener>
    <listener-class>org.springframework.web.context.ContextLoaderListener</listener-class>
</listener>

<!-- 配置加载 Spring 配置文件的位置和名称 -->
<context-param>
    <param-name>contextConfigLocation</param-name>
    <param-value>classpath:spring.xml</param-value>
</context-param>

注意:如果不配置context-param那么需要把配置文件放到指定的位置,并且名称也不能自定义,名称必须为applicationContext.xml,路径必须要是/WEB-INF/

四、配置web.xml

使用监听器监听服务器的启动,当服务器启动时,首先会初始化监听器。

<?xml version="1.0" encoding="UTF-8"?>
<web-app xmlns="http://xmlns.jcp.org/xml/ns/javaee"
         x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
         xsi:schemaLocation="http://xmlns.jcp.org/xml/ns/javaee http://xmlns.jcp.org/xml/ns/javaee/web-app_4_0.xsd"
         version="4.0">

    <!-- 配置监听器,当服务器启动时,初始化 Spring IOC 容器 -->
    <listener>
        <listener-class>org.springframework.web.context.ContextLoaderListener</listener-class>
    </listener>

    <!-- 配置加载 Spring 配置文件的位置和名称 -->
    <context-param>
        <param-name>contextConfigLocation</param-name>
        <param-value>classpath:spring.xml</param-value>
    </context-param>

    <!-- 配置 SpringMVC 的编码过滤器 -->
    <filter>
        <filter-name>CharacterEncodingFilter</filter-name>
        <filter-class>org.springframework.web.filter.CharacterEncodingFilter</filter-class>
        <init-param>
            <param-name>encoding</param-name>
            <param-value>UTF-8</param-value>
        </init-param>
        <init-param>
            <param-name>forceResponseEncoding</param-name>
            <param-value>true</param-value>
        </init-param>
    </filter>
    <filter-mapping>
        <filter-name>CharacterEncodingFilter</filter-name>
        <url-pattern>/*</url-pattern>
    </filter-mapping>

    <!-- 配置处理请求方式的过滤器 -->
    <filter>
        <filter-name>HiddenHttpMethodFilter</filter-name>
        <filter-class>org.springframework.web.filter.HiddenHttpMethodFilter</filter-class>
    </filter>
    <filter-mapping>
        <filter-name>HiddenHttpMethodFilter</filter-name>
        <url-pattern>/*</url-pattern>
    </filter-mapping>

    <!-- 配置 DispatcherServlet -->
    <servlet>
        <servlet-name>DispatcherServlet</servlet-name>
        <servlet-class>org.springframework.web.servlet.DispatcherServlet</servlet-class>
        <init-param>
            <param-name>contextConfigLocation</param-name>
            <param-value>classpath:springmvc.xml</param-value>
        </init-param>
        <load-on-startup>1</load-on-startup>
    </servlet>
    <servlet-mapping>
        <servlet-name>DispatcherServlet</servlet-name>
        <url-pattern>/</url-pattern>
    </servlet-mapping>
</web-app>

八、创建Spring.xml

SqlSessionFactoryBean会在Spring IOC容器中产生一个sqlSession对象。

MapperScannerConfigurer创建指定包下的所有接口的代理类对象,配置了它,就不需要使用sqlSession.getMapper(Employee.class)创建一个代理类了。MapperScannerConfigurer创建的代理类对象放在Spring IOC容器中,所以我们可以直接使用注解方式进行自动注入。

@Resource
private EmployeeMapper employeeMapper;
employeeMapper.getAllEmployee();
// 以前的写法
EmployeeMapper mapper = sqlSession.getMapper(Employee.class);
mapper.getAllEmployee();

id="transactionManager"可以省略transaction-manager="transactionManager"

<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
       x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
       xmlns:context="http://www.springframework.org/schema/context" 
       xmlns:tx="http://www.springframework.org/schema/tx"
       xsi:schemaLocation="http://www.springframework.org/schema/beans
       http://www.springframework.org/schema/beans/spring-beans.xsd
       http://www.springframework.org/schema/context
       https://www.springframework.org/schema/context/spring-context.xsd 
       http://www.springframework.org/schema/tx http://www.springframework.org/schema/tx/spring-tx.xsd">

    <!-- 扫描组件(除控制层) -->
    <context:component-scan base-package="top.lukeewin.ssm">
        <context:exclude-filter type="annotation" expression="org.springframework.stereotype.Controller"/>
    </context:component-scan>

    <!-- 引入 jdbc.properties 文件 -->
    <context:property-placeholder location="classpath:jdbc.properties"/>

    <!-- 数据源 -->
    <bean id="dataSource" class="com.alibaba.druid.pool.DruidDataSource">
        <property name="driverClassName" value="${jdbc.driver}"/>
        <property name="url" value="${jdbc.url}"/>
        <property name="username" value="${jdbc.username}"/>
        <property name="password" value="${jdbc.password}"/>
    </bean>

    <!-- 配置事务管理器 -->
    <bean id="transactionManager" class="org.springframework.jdbc.datasource.DataSourceTransactionManager">
        <property name="dataSource" ref="dataSource"/>
    </bean>

    <!--
        开启事务注解驱动
        将使用注解 @Transactional 标识的方法或类中的所有方法进行事务管理
    -->
    <tx:annotation-driven transaction-manager="transactionManager"/>

    <!-- 配置 SqlSessionFactoryBean,可以直接在 Spring IOC 中获取 SqlSessionFactory -->
    <bean class="org.mybatis.spring.SqlSessionFactoryBean">
        <!-- 设置加载 MyBatis 的核心配置文件的路径 -->
        <property name="configLocation" value="classpath:mybatis-config.xml"/>
        <!-- 设置数据源 -->
        <property name="dataSource" ref="dataSource"/>
        <!-- 设置类型别名所对应的包 -->
        <property name="typeAliasesPackage" value="top.lukeewin.ssm.pojo"/>
        <!-- 设置映射文件的路径,只有映射的包和 mapper 接口的包不一致时才需要设置 -->
        <!--<property name="mapperLocations" value="classpath:mappers/*.xml"/>-->
    </bean>

    <!--
        配置 mapper 接口的扫描,可以将指定包下的所有 mapper 接口
        通过 SqlSession 创建的代理实现类对象,并将这些对象交给 IOC 容器管理
    -->
    <bean class="org.mybatis.spring.mapper.MapperScannerConfigurer">
        <property name="basePackage" value="top.lukeewin.ssm.mapper"/>
    </bean>
</beans>

九、创建mybatis-config.xml

<?xml version="1.0" encoding="UTF-8" ?>
<!DOCTYPE configuration
        PUBLIC "-//mybatis.org//DTD Config 3.0//EN"
        "https://mybatis.org/dtd/mybatis-3-config.dtd">
<configuration>

    <!--
        MyBatis核心配置文件中的标签必须要按照指定的顺序配置
        properties?,settings?,typeAliases?,typeHandlers?,
        objectFactory?,objectWrapperFactory?,reflectorFactory?,
        plugins?,environments?,databaseIdProvider?,mappers?
    -->

    <settings>
        <setting name="mapUnderscoreToCamelCase" value="true"/>
    </settings>

    <!-- 配置分页插件 -->
    <plugins>
        <plugin interceptor="com.github.pagehelper.PageInterceptor"/>
    </plugins>
</configuration>

十、分页显示数据

pageNum:当前页的页码

pageSize:每页显示的条数

size:当前页显示的真实条数

total:总记录数

pages:总页数

prePage:上一页

nextPage:下一页

isFirstPage/isLastPage:是否为第一页/是否为最后一页

hasPreviousPage/hasNextPage:是否存在上一页/下一页

navigatePages:导航分页的页码数

navigatepageNums:导航分页的页码,[1,2,3,4,5]

list:存储从数据库中获取过来的数据

Controller

@Override
public PageInfo<Employee> getEmployeePage(Integer pageNum) {
    // 开启分页功能
    PageHelper.startPage(pageNum, 4);
    List<Employee> list = employeeMapper.getAllEmployee();
    // 获取分页相关数据
    PageInfo<Employee> page = new PageInfo<>(list, 5);
    return page;
}

前端

添加页面跳转

<div style="text-align: center">
    <a th:if="${page.hasPreviousPage}" th:href="@{/employee/page/1}">首页</a>
    <a th:if="${page.hasPreviousPage}" th:href="@{'/employee/page/' + ${page.prePage}}">上一页</a>
    <span th:each="num : ${page.navigatepageNums}">
        <a th:if="${page.pageNum == num}" style="color: red" th:href="@{'/employee/page/' + ${num}}" th:text="'[' + ${num} + ']'"></a>
        <a th:if="${page.pageNum != num}" th:href="@{'/employee/page/' + ${num}}" th:text="${num}"></a>
    </span>
    <a th:if="${page.hasNextPage}" th:href="@{'/employee/page/' + ${page.nextPage}}">下一页</a>
    <a th:if="${page.hasNextPage}" th:href="@{'/employee/page/' + ${page.pages}}">尾页</a>
</div>
